Faculty of education (Ibn al-Haitham) holds a lecture on environment and remote sensing


Faculty of education for pure sciences (Ibn al-Haitham) at University of Baghdad held a lecture on (environment and remote sensing science). This lecture was organized by the unit of remote sensing and image processing at the department. It was delivered by Assistant Prof. Dr. Hamid Majid an instructor at the department and attended by a number of lecturers and graduate students. The lecture dealt with the importance of shrinking of water surfaces and the depletion of natural resources in the globe in general and Iraq in particular. It reviewed the Iraq water policy compared with the neighboring countries benefiting from Tigris and Euphrates rivers also the future status was drawn until (2020) in order to explain the need of water resources with what is available currently. At the conclusion of the lecture, a set of proposals were submitted for improving water reality and vegetation in order to minimize negative phenomena of the environmental change experienced in Iraq.
